Ceremony hails families of martyred religious minorities in Iran
Conference on “Spiritual Solidarity of Religions for Honor of Iran” was held at the headquarter of the center in Tehran hailing families of Christian and Zoroastrian martyrs of the Islamic Revolution and Iraq war, reported Taqrib News Agency (TNA).
 
Families of religious minorities including mother of Farhad Khadem, Zoroastrian martyr of the Iraq war, Forouq Menha, mother of three Muslim martyrs, Matarineh Honarchian mother of Zoric Moradi, the first Christian martyr of the Iraq and a number of others were hailed in this ceremony.
 
Top religious figures and representatives of each minority groups attended the ceremony.
 
The ceremony opened with recitation of verses from the holy Qur’an, holy Bible, Torah and Avesta by representatives of each religious group.
On the eve of the 40th anniversary of Iran’s Islamic Revolution conference on “Spiritual Solidarity of Religions for Honor of Iran” was held by the Organization of Culture and Islamic Relations in Tehran on Monday January 15.
 
Iran is home to Christian, Zoroastrian and also Jewish people besides the majority of Muslims, both Shia and Sunni denominations.
